1902-04-02 Institution established. Original name: The Caroline County Bank.
1998-02-07 Merged into and subsequently operated as part of Farmers Bank of Maryland in Annapolis, Maryland.
1999-05-15 Acquired First Virginia Bank-maryland in Upper Marlboro, Maryland.
2000-01-01 Reorganized.
2003-10-11 Merged into and subsequently operated as part of Branch Banking and Trust Company in Winston Salem, North Carolina.
